Hartford, March 20, 2003 -- The Hartford Wolf Pack play back-to-back home games tomorrow night vs. the Bridgeport Sound Tigers and Saturday evening against the Saint John Flames. Faceoff for both games is 7:05 PM. Tomorrow night is a Family Night at the Hartford Civic Center, and Saturday's game features "Nick Fotiu Bobblehead Night" and "'70's Night".
For tomorrow night's game, Family Night packages of four tickets, four Kayem hot dogs, or slices of pizza, four sodas and a team souvenir are available for as low as $56. Family Night packages can be ordered through the Wolf Pack ticket office at 860-548-2000. Tomorrow is also "East Hartford Town Night" at the Civic Center. East Hartford residents showing I.D. can purchase tickets at the Civic Center box office for just $12 each, and a portion of the proceeds from those tickets will be donated to Project Graduation.
Saturday night the first 2,003 kids 12 or under will receive a bobblehead doll of Wolf Pack assistant coach, and former New York Ranger and Hartford and New England Whaler, Nick Fotiu. That is courtesy of Morande Ford/Acura. The Wolf Pack will be sporting special "throwback" jerseys, modeled after a vintage-1976 New York Ranger sweater, and fans can compete in a '70's-themed "best costume" contest.
